Personalization Techniques
The first step in apron decorating is deciding how you want to personalize it. Some popular techniques include embroidery, fabric paints, and iron-on patches. Embroidery allows you to add intricate and colorful designs or even your initials for that custom touch. If needlework isn't your thing, consider using fabric paints to draw patterns or write slogans that resonate with your grilling spirit.

Accessorizing Your Apron
Adding accessories to your apron can boost both the fashion and function of your cooking attire. Think along the lines of practical additions like pockets or decorative trims. For a more functional accessory, why not sew additional loops to hang grilling tools? For those who are more sartorially minded, consider adding a touch of flair with colorful buttons or tassels.
Sustainability in Apron Crafting
When working on your apron project, keep sustainability in mind. Upcycle old clothes to create patches or use leftover fabrics for pocket linings. This not only makes the process eco-friendly but also adds a story to your apron, something you can share with guests during your barbecues. FAQs About Apron Decorating
How can I add extra pockets to my barbecue apron?
To add pockets, cut fabrics in your desired size and shape, hem the edges, and sew them onto your apron. Use heavy-duty thread for durability, especially if the pockets will hold grilling tools.
What are some easy starter projects for apron decoration?
For beginners, using fabric paints or iron-on patches are the easiest ways to start. These methods require minimal tools and offer high visual impact with less effort.
